IRAN'S REFORMIST NEWSPAPER IS SHUT DOWN IN TEHRAN
Journalists of Iran's leading reformist newspaper Shargh sit in the newspaper's office in Tehran, Iran after it was shut down on August 6, 2007. The paper was allegedly shut down by the government for interviewing an opposition poet that disputed Islamic views, according to the paper's editor. (UPI Photo/Mohammad Kheirkhah)
